Decision for international employment in the meeting of the Chairman PM Youth Program with the Prime Minister
..(Asghar Ali Mubarak).Youth are the valuable asset of any country and its bright future. There is a large portion of the youth population in Pakistan, and the Prime Minister Youth Program of the Government of Pakistan is a milestone in giving the right direction to their talents.

Chairman Prime Minister Youth Program Rana Mashhood Ahmed Khan held an important meeting with Prime Minister Muhammad Shehbaz Sharif in which a detailed review of the measures related to the promotion of technical education, skills and hospitality sector in Pakistan was taken. The high-level meeting discussed in detail various measures to increase international employment opportunities for Pakistani youth and prepare them according to the changing requirements of the global market, while important issues related to the establishment of “Country of Destination Centres” to provide better access to employment opportunities to the youth at the global level were also considered. A strategy was formulated to provide basic language training, cultural awareness, work environment and other necessary professional training to the youth aspiring to work abroad according to the needs and employment requirements of the respective countries through these specific centers. The meeting specifically emphasized that the youth aspiring to work abroad should be made aware of the language, culture, work environment and basic requirements of the respective country before departure. Prime Minister Muhammad Shehbaz Sharif strictly directed the concerned authorities to equip the youth with modern technical and professional skills according to the changing requirements of the global market. The meeting reaffirmed the commitment to make training opportunities for youth in the fields of skills, technical education and hospitality more effective so that, as part of the government’s primary objective, Pakistani youth can access maximum employment opportunities at the international level by providing world-class education, skills and training.

A comprehensive talent hunt program is going to be launched in Pakistan on the basis of merit and transparency, where the culture of recommendation will be completely eliminated and only talent will be brought forward. At the end of this talent hunt, the government of Pakistan will organize a magnificent Pakistan Hockey League. The International Hockey Federation will be the official partner of the academy and the government for the draft of players in this league, through which renowned international players from around the world will come to Pakistani soil and play matches.
